Output 39d61bf0eae3241da6d08bf2c43af88303e7c998c9b0da2e2161e4737833df73:3

value
489505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b96e54c0d86c3522a07767f039482942e9043fa2 OP_EQUAL
address
3JbV6yB9Y13HNbfktchFx71wWvsWVb8ckK
transaction
39d61bf0eae3241da6d08bf2c43af88303e7c998c9b0da2e2161e4737833df73
spent
true